Understanding the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the specifics of replacement key services, it's necessary to comprehend the various types of car keys readily available today. Here are some typical types:
Traditional Keys: These are fundamental metal keys with no electronic components. They are the easiest to duplicate and are frequently inexpensive to replace.
Transponder Keys: These keys consist of a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system. When the key is inserted, the chip sends a signal that allows the car to begin. Changing these keys is more complicated and usually needs shows.
Key Fobs: A key fob is a remote control that locks/unlocks the doors and might also begin the vehicle. Replacing a key fob can be costly, specifically if shows is required.
Smart Keys: Commonly found in modern lorries, wise keys allow the car replacement keys near me to be opened and begun without physically placing the key into the ignition. Replacement normally requires professional support.

Automotive dealerships are often the most trusted source for car replacement keys, especially for more recent designs. They have access to the maker's requirements and can guarantee that you receive a genuine key. Nevertheless, this choice can be costly and lengthy.
2. Regional Locksmiths
Lots of regional locksmith professionals are now licensed to handle car key replacements, particularly for transponder keys and fobs. They typically use more competitive pricing compared to dealerships and might offer faster service. It's vital to pick a locksmith with a good reputation and experience in automotive locksmithing.
3. Hardware Stores
Some hardware stores have key duplication devices for fundamental car keys. While this option is affordable, it usually only uses to non-electronic keys. If your vehicle utilizes a transponder or clever key, this may not be the best option.
4. Mobile Key Replacement Services
Mobile key replacement services send a technician straight to your location, normally within a brief period. They can frequently use competitive costs and can deal with a wide variety of key types. Make certain to verify their credentials and customer reviews before employing.

The time it takes to get a car key replaced can differ. Dealerships may take a few days, while locksmith professionals or mobile services can often replace a key on the same day.
Can I replace my key myself?
While you can replace some basic keys yourself, intricate keys like transponder keys and smart keys normally need specialized devices to program. It's best to consult a professional for these types.
Is it cheaper to get a replacement key from a locksmith professional or a dealership?
Typically, locksmiths provide more competitive rates compared to dealers. Nevertheless, car dealership keys might come with enhanced safety and guarantee.
What should I do if I lose my keys while taking a trip?
If you lose your keys while taking a trip, call a local automotive locksmith, or your dealership for emergency services. Be prepared to verify ownership of the vehicle.
